Untouched on unimpaired (6) Crossword Clue
Answer: INTACT (6 letters)
The answer to the crossword clue "Untouched on unimpaired" with 6 letters is "INTACT".Intact means something that remains whole, unbroken, or undamaged, without any parts being altered or harmed. It is used to describe objects, conditions, or situations that have been preserved in their original state, such as a building after a storm or a person's reputation after a scandal.

Intact is a straightforward adjective used across everyday language to describe objects, structures, or conditions that remain complete and undisturbed:
Origin and usage:
- Derived from Latin intactus from in- “not” + tactus “touched,” indicating something not touched or broken.
- Entered English through Latin/French influences, maintaining the sense of being whole or undamaged.
Examples:
- “The vase remained intact after the fall.”
- “The integrity of the system stayed intact despite the setback.”
